WebThe easiest and most common way to smooth PLA 3D prints is to sand and paint them. This process is the most time-consuming, but it yields excellent results when done thoroughly. With sanding, you are physically … Web18 dec. 2024 · History. The Ironing idea was first proposed in 2016 by the Spanish user “Neotko” on the Ultimaker community forum. Neotko prototyped “Neosanding” – a smoothing of top surfaces in Simplify3D by running a second infill phase at the same print height with zero or a tiny extrusion rate perpendicularly to the first infill run. massey ferguson 8560 https://roschi.net
